Always a Great Stay
I have reviewed this property before, so I won’t go into a lot of detail, other than to say it’s always fantastic. You don’t actually see any Best Western signage any place, but it is part of their Premier Collection. Immaculately, clean and safe. If you park, they do have valet parking, I usually take the MAX when I’m in downtown Portland, and the convention center station is catty corner from the hotel, less than a two or three minute walk. Always immaculately clean, reception is friendly and courteous. Fantastic rooftop restaurant and bar. Can’t say enough nice things.

Clean, friendly and the best beds!!
The customer service at this hotel was top-notch. From offering greet personalized restaurant recommendations to giving us extra bedding for our little kids to their general friendliness, it felt like they had a genuine desire to take good care of us during our stay. FYI— they check in with their guests by text and you can text them questions anytime, which is super convenient. The beds were a 10 out of 10 in comfort. It’s been a while since we had a great hotel experience and it was a relief to find that it was still possible! Very walkable to MODA CENTER, too.
